It is a simple and safe procedure but requires expertise to perform the hair transplantation and manage complications, if any.

In a hair transplant surgery, the healthcare provider takes grafts or tiny pieces of skin that contain healthy hair.

These grafts are usually on your head or at the back of the scalp, where the hair grows thickest.
